The Samsung Galaxy S6 Edge has a global score of 85.7, which is much better than HTC One M8s's 66.5 general score. The Samsung Galaxy S6 Edge construction is noticeably thinner and somewhat lighter than HTC One M8s. Both phones we are comparing use the same Android 5.0 OS (Operating System). Samsung Galaxy S6 Edge features a little bit better looking display than HTC One M8s, because it has a better pixel density, a higher 2560 x 1440 resolution and a quite bigger display.
The Galaxy S6 Edge has much more memory capacity to install games and applications than HTC One M8s, because although it has no SD extension slot, it also counts with 128 GB internal storage. Samsung Galaxy S6 Edge counts with a really superior performance than HTC One M8s, because it has a 64 bits CPU, an extra GPU, a larger number of cores and a greater amount of RAM memory.
HTC One M8s features just a little better battery lifetime than Samsung Galaxy S6 Edge, because it has 2840mAh of battery capacity against 2600mAh. The Samsung Galaxy S6 Edge features a little bit better camera than HTC One M8s, because it has a camera with more mega-pixels, a larger aperture to take better photography and videos in low-light environments and a lot higher (4K) video resolution.
The Samsung Galaxy S6 Edge and the HTC One M8s cost exactly the same, which makes it easy to pick between these devices.
